Greater is a biographical sports drama film that was released in 2016. The movie is directed by David Hunt and is based on the true story of the late Arkansas Razorbacks walk-on football player Brandon Burlsworth. The movie aims to showcase Burlsworth's journey from a small-town Arkansas football player to becoming an All-American and NFL draft pick. The movie is set in the 1990s in Arkansas, where Brandon Burlsworth (Christopher Severio) is a young boy who loves playing football. He dreams of playing for the Arkansas Razorbacks, but his small size and lack of athleticism prevent him from joining the team. However, Brandon's determination and work ethic keep him motivated, and he eventually earns a spot on the team as a walk-on. This achievement is significant for the young player, as walk-ons rarely make it onto the field. Despite being constantly ridiculed by his teammates, Burlsworth remains focused on his goal of becoming a starter for the Razorbacks. He spends countless hours in the weight room and on the practice field, working tirelessly to improve his skills. As Burlsworth's hard work begins to pay off, he becomes a vital member of the team. He becomes an All-American and is eventually drafted by the Indianapolis Colts. Throughout the movie, the audience is introduced to Brandon's family, including his parents, played by Neal McDonough and Leslie Easterbrook. The family is initially apprehensive about Brandon's dreams of playing football, but they eventually come to support him wholeheartedly. The movie also highlights the close relationship between Burlsworth and his younger brother, Marty (Nick Searcy). Marty becomes Brandon's biggest supporter and is always there for him, both on and off the field.
